SUB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review

751 of the 6,301 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Short-Term National Muni Bond ETF (SUB)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$7.85B — down 8.5% from $8.57B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 62 funds opened new SUB positions and 53 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 253 added to existing stakes and 319 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$55.7M. The largest seller was Jane Street, cutting an estimated $306M.
